Hong Kong - Made to Measure Boots

I will be working in Hong Kong for a two month period, and my wife will be joining me for a short break in that time.

Can anyone recommend anywhere that custom makes made to measure female boots? My wife has trouble finding boots that will fit her, and needs wider calf fitting. I don't know how long they would take to make, though my wife could go for a fitting and I could pick up later when she has returned home.

There is definitely a shop in the Princes Building that offers made-to-measure footwear. It's a very small shop -- it looks like a typical shoe repair shop in the US. Unfortunately, I don't its name, but the Princes Building is fairly small and you should be able to find the shop either through the information board or by asking a guard.

The Princes Building is in Central, adjacent to the MTR station.
